Kahleah Copper missed Thursday’s game for personal reasons, leaving the Sky more shorthanded than they already were. They stayed competitive against Indiana on Thursday as Marina Mabrey scored a career-high 36 points, but a jumper by Kelsey Mitchell with 0.9 seconds left gave the Fever a 2-point win.
